2012-08-22 30 views

回答

2

將一個本地版本的Wordpress部署到活動服務器上是相當容易的。首先,你是對的,我不打擾在你的服務器上安裝Wordpress的乾淨副本,然後你必須完全重建網站。

你需要做的是;

  1. FTP從本地機器到服務器的所有文件。
  2. 轉自本地的phpmyadmin整個數據庫到新的數據庫服務器上的
  3. 變化的wp-config.php文件
  4. 數據庫連接的細節讓你的WordPress默認的.htaccess任何必要的更改。我的意思是你的MAMP網站可能不在根目錄下,但你的網站可能會是。如果你設置了SEO永久鏈接,那麼你將從重寫規則和.htaccess中的基礎中刪除Mamp子目錄。您的主機可能還要求您在此處添加規則(即指定要使用哪個版本的PHP等)。你可以使用他們的安裝程序來安裝Wordpress,看他們是否自己添加任何特殊的規則。

這一切都很簡單 - 現在來了我的提示。將Wordpress數據庫從本地開發環境移動到現場可能是一個巨大的麻煩,因爲Wordpress(以及大量的插件/主題開發人員)使用序列化數組來存儲數據。因此,如果您在數據庫上執行查找和替換操作以將舊網址替換爲新網址,則會禁用諸如配置設置和窗口小部件(特別是文本窗口小部件)的許多功能,但是最終必須重新創建大量內容)。

下載此文件;

http://interconnectit.com/124/search-and-replace-for-wordpress-databases/

,並把它上傳到它直接在瀏覽器中的服務器和接入。運行快速表單並執行序列化數組友好查找並替換您的數據庫URL。任務完成。祝你好運。

+0

如果我對此有更多的問題,我一定會問你...謝謝... – lakesh

+0

沒問題@lakesh,如果你有更多的問題,我會盡我所能幫助 - 我上傳3個WordPress站點現在使用這種技術,互連腳本使事情變得更快。 – McNab